## Support

The file `lintline.baseline.json` pins known findings from the Quarrel static-analysis suite so that only new violations fail CI. Reviewers should confirm that baseline regenerations are justified in the PR description and do not silently absorb fresh issues. Deliberate suppressions must reference a tracked exception in the Marrowgate registry. If a baseline diff looks suspicious or you need an audit trail, reach the Quarrel maintainers at the address below.

escalation mailbox, bafog-fafog: ulador@paliqlabs.internal

Support team: the nightly orphaned-resource sweeper in the Hollowgate CI environment started deleting volumes that were still attached to paused Ferncrest jobs. The sweeper's grace period was measured from creation time, not last-attach time, so anything paused longer than six hours was collected. We patched the predicate and re-verified against a snapshot of yesterday's inventory; no further false deletions occurred. The corrected sweeper build carries the identifier below.

build token for kagaf-hahof: htk14_9d3d4d26d7d8de

### Step 2 — Lock down the Bookbarrow importer

Quick one for security review: the new catalogue import in Bookbarrow pulls MARC files from the partner drop zone, so we've sandboxed the parser and disabled remote entity resolution. Upload size limits and the allowlist are enforced at the worker, not the gateway. Please check the hardened settings below before we flip it on.

deployment values, yadug-bawif:
[framir]
team = pelox
access_code = ac_a38ab2
owner = tamion.julael
host = framir.tolvaqlabs.test
port = 11211
peer = tammir.zemvargrid.local
salt = 2215ef03
pin = 1541

Subject: TileSprint prefetcher rollout tonight

Heads up for on-call: the Maplace tile prefetcher now warms zoom levels 8–12 ahead of viewport pans. Watch cache-hit ratios during the first hour; anything below 70% means the warm queue stalled and you should roll back. The exact build we promoted is traceable below.

pipeline stamp: htk31_f769b577b3028a4e9958e5bb8d1259a